Transaction 93e6713fef1ab0d2503678171ee7bd58506fdbe8a02ef148274462606934e7f7
1 Input
1 Output
-
93e6713fef1ab0d2503678171ee7bd58506fdbe8a02ef148274462606934e7f7:0
- value
- 393052
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1bd136cf12ab6374b7ed24854842d911007a2284 OP_EQUAL
- address
- 34E6oB1sLQDgwNYqUgU44frTRVPQnnbynC